Christian Lee intends to return to ONE Championship but will need to find a new camp, with his father having “completely retired” as a coach, according to Chatri Sityodtong.

Chairman and CEO Chatri revealed this week that Angela Lee – ONE’s atomweight MMA champion – is “likely to retire” following the death of her sister and fellow fighter Victoria Lee at 18 last December.

Angela’s brother Christian, who holds ONE’s lightweight and welterweight MMA titles, is “100 per cent” coming back, but will take the rest of the year off, Chatri told the Post.

The siblings were all coached by their father Ken Lee at the family’s United MMA gym in Hawaii, which reportedly “permanently closed” in January.

“I try my best to be as supportive as possible from their perspective, not mine,” Chatri told the Post after Saturday’s ONE Fight Night 11 card in Bangkok. “I talked to Angela two days ago. She said, ‘Chatri, I’m likely going to retire, I haven’t fully decided yet.’
